The Hot Potatoes plugin allows faculty to create and upload an interactive quiz to Moodle.
Who can use it?
Faculty.
What is the purpose of Hot Potatoes?
Hot Potatoes is a quiz authoring program that creates questions that can be imported into eLearn.
Quizzes are created on the instructor’s computer and then uploaded to the eLearn course. After students have attempted the quizzes, a number of reports are available which show how individual questions were answered and some statistical trends in the scores.
The Hot Potatoes suite includes six applications, enabling you to create interactive question types:
- Multiple-choice,
- Short-answer,
- Jumbled-sentence,
- Crossword,
- Matching/ordering,
- Gap-fill exercises
